Set within a 14th-century building, this apartment retains much of its Old-World charm, but with otherwise contemporary mod-cons for the utmost comfort. Inside it's exposed wooden rafters, plaster walls and original fixtures galore, exuding heaps of historic character. A large and cosy bedroom boasts access to a small terrace with typical wrought-iron railing, while two bathrooms present sleek hotel-style finishes – it's this contrast that we really love about the home. Also, its location at the quieter end of the restaurant-lined Rue de Buci, in the heart of Saint-Germain-des-Prés (filled with shops, art galleries and classy cafés), is the perfect spot for a peaceful getaway to the city of love. You're removed from the flocks of tourists and intense crowds, and yet two minutes from Café de Flore and under a ten-minute stroll from the Louvre and the Luxembourg Gardens, making it an enviable place to call home.

About Saint Germain des Prés - Odéon
Saint-Germain-des-Prés has it all: location, buzz, romance, a bohemian past, luxury shopping, art galleries, as well as famous monuments, historic churches and of course its iconic cafes, where intellectuals like Sartre and Hemingway used to hang out back in the day. Cross the Seine at Pont des Arts
The Pont des Arts is a pedestrian bridge built under Napoleon I. It crosses the River Seine and links the Institut de France to the central square (cour carrée) of the Palais du Louvre.
